If you asked to comment on, "like", or share the fake Facebook post: "His parents can't afford surgery so facebook and cnn are paying half of the expenses," please do not, because it is a despicable hoax and scam used by scammers to trick Facebook users into "liking", sharing, or commenting on a Facebook page, in order to make the page popular.
Please Dont Ignore !His parents can't afford surgery so facebook and cnn are paying half of the expenses1 like - $11 comment - 10$1 share - 100$
1 Like = 1 $ 1 Comment = 3 $ 1 Share = 10 $Please Don't Ignore ! :'(13,156 people claimed this offer
Facebook will not or never donate money based on likes, comments, and shares. This is a sick attempt by the page administrators to exploit a picture only for the sake of getting a lot of likes, therefore making the Facebook page popular.
